/*
	Data: junho 2006
	Autor: Joneson Carneiro
	Site: www.cabofrionews.com.br
	
*/

body { margin:0px; text-align:center; cursor:default;
 background:#720000 url(../imagens/lateral_01.jpg) 1px 170px no-repeat;
  color:#FFF; font:0.7em/1.5em Arial; }

#geral {}

#conteudo { font-size:1.1em; width:60%; float:left; text-align:justify; margin:0px 10px 10px 130px; }

* HTML #conteudo { width:60%; float:left; text-align:justify; margin:0px 10px 10px 60px; }

h1 { text-indent:-99999px; height:155px; }

h2, h4, .submition legend { color:#F1D707; margin-left:25px;
 background:URL(../imagens/estrela1.gif) no-repeat; padding:3px 0 3px 5px; text-indent:20px; font-weight:bold; font-size:1.6em; text-transform:uppercase; }

acronym { cursor:help; margin:0px; }

p { text-indent:25px; }

p:first-letter { font-size:1.9em; font-weight:bold; padding-right:1px; color:#F1D707; }

a { color:#FC0; text-decoration:none; }
a:hover { text-decoration:underline; }

.criativo, .intro, .inspiracao, .publicar, .validacao, .table_gallery, .submition, .licensa 
{ background:url(../imagens/division.gif) left bottom repeat-x; padding-bottom:30px; }

/*....... DIVS EXTRAS........*/
.background1 {  }
.background2 { background:url(../imagens/bg1.gif) top repeat-x; width:100%; }

/*.........................*/

/*....... NAVEGAÇÃO........*/
.navegacao { font-size:1.1em;
width:20%; 
background:url(../imagens/degrade1.gif) top left no-repeat; 
float:right; margin:160px 10px 0 0; 
text-align:left; padding:10px 0 0 10px; }

.menu { background:url(../imagens/tit_menu.gif) no-repeat; width:100%; text-indent:-999999px; margin:0px; padding:0px; }
.links { margin:0px; padding:0px; }
.links li { list-style-type:none; margin:1px 0px; display:block; }
.links li a { background:url(../imagens/estrela_laranja.gif) 0px 3px no-repeat; text-decoration:none; padding-left:15px; color:#FC0; }
.links li a:hover { background:url(../imagens/setinha.gif) 0px 3px no-repeat; text-decoration:none; color:#FFF; }
.escolha { background:url(../imagens/tit_escolha.gif) no-repeat; width:100%; text-indent:-999999px; margin:0px; margin-top:8px; padding:0px 0px 6px 0px; }
.template_list { margin:0px; padding:0 0 200px 0; background:url(../imagens/flag.gif) bottom left no-repeat; }
.template_list li { list-style-type:none; background:url(../imagens/estrela1.gif) 0px 0px no-repeat; padding-left:24px; display:block; }
.template_list li a { text-decoration:none; font-size:1.1em; color:#FC0; display:block; }
.template_list li a:hover { color:#FFF; text-decoration:none; }
.template_list strong {}
/*.........................*/

/*....... INTRODUÇÃO........*/
.intro {margin:0px 10px 0 20px; }
.intro h2 { background:url(../imagens/tit_introducao.gif) no-repeat; width:100%; height:128px; text-indent:-99999px; }
/*.........................*/


/*....... TABLE GALLERY........*/

.table_gallery { margin:0px 10px 0 20px;padding-bottom:60px;}
.table_gallery h2 { background:url(../imagens/tit_regulamento.gif) no-repeat; width:100%; height:46px; text-indent:-999999px;}
#tabela { text-align:center; background-color:#9C0404; width:100%; border:1px solid #990D0D; }
#tabela thead, #tabela th { text-align:center; background:#5F0202 url(../imagens/bg_table2.gif) repeat-x; color:#F1D707;}
#tabela tfoot {}
#tabela tfoot td { text-transform:uppercase; font-weight:bold; padding-left:10px;}
#tabela tbody { text-align:center; }
#tabela caption { background:url(../imagens/tit_layouts.gif) no-repeat; text-indent:-9999999px; width:100%; height:27px; }
#tabela th { padding:2px; }
#tabela td { padding:2px; background:url(../imagens/bg_table.gif) repeat-x; border:1px solid #6B0303; }

/*.........................*/

/*....... Fotos........*/
div.album {float:left; width:25%;border:1px solid #999; margin:0.2em; padding:0.5em;text-align:center; font-style:italic ; font-size:smaller;}

.escala {width:100%;border:0; }

/* tratamento de foto media cabofrio_news_media.php */

div.album_media  {width:100%; padding:0.5em; text-align:center;}
.escala_media {border:0;}

/*....... SUBMITION........*/
.submition { padding-bottom:60px; }
form { padding:0px; margin:0px; }
.campo_bloco { }
.submition fieldset { margin:0px 10px 0 20px;border:0px; }
.submition legend { margin-bottom:10px; text-indent:20px; padding-top:2px; }
.campo_bloco { width:100%; }
.campo_bloco label { width:120px; background-color:#620202; float:left; padding-right:30px; margin-right:4px; text-align:right; }

.txtfield
 { border-top:1px solid #4B0101; border-left:1px solid #4B0101; border-bottom:1px solid #CF4242; border-right:1px solid #CF4242; }
 
.botao { border:1px solid #000; display:block; margin:5px 0 0 182px; background-color:#5B0101; color:#FFF; }

/*.........................*/

/*....... RODAPÉ........*/
.rodape {clear:both; font-weight:bold; font-size:1.5em;}

/*.........................*/
